Как изменить фигуру и оформление примечания в Excel: 5 способов настройки

Зачем и когда нужно изменять форму примечаний в Excel

Примечания в Microsoft Excel — это не просто текстовые подсказки, а мощный инструмент для аннотирования данных, который часто остаётся недооценённым. По умолчанию они отображаются в виде жёлтых прямоугольников с загнутым уголком, но мало кто знает, что их внешний вид можно полностью трансформировать. Изменение формы примечания может быть полезно в нескольких случаях:

Во-первых, это визуальное выделение важных комментариев. Например, красные треугольники с восклицательным знаком удобно использовать для обозначения критических ошибок в данных, а зелёные облака — для положительных трендов. Во-вторых, кастомизация помогает адаптировать таблицы под корпоративный стиль компании, где все документы должны соответствовать фирменным цветам и шрифтам. Наконец, нестандартные формы (стрелки, звёзды, выноски) делают отчёты более наглядными при презентациях или печати.

Важно понимать, что изменение формы примечания не влияет на его функциональность — только на внешний вид. Все настройки сохраняются вместе с файлом, поэтому коллеги увидят ваши правки при открытии документа. В этой статье мы разберём все доступные способы кастомизации: от базовых параметров до скрытых возможностей, о которых не пишут даже в официальной документации.

Способ 1: Изменение формы примечания через контекстное меню

Самый быстрый метод трансформации внешнего вида — использование встроенных инструментов форматирования. Он подходит для Excel 2010–2023 и Microsoft 365, а также частично работает в онлайн-версии. Вот пошаговая инструкция:

  1. Откройте лист с примечанием и щёлкните правой кнопкой мыши по ячейке, содержащей комментарий.
  2. В контекстном меню выберите пункт Изменить примечание (или Edit Comment в английской версии).
  3. Наведите курсор на рамку примечания — появится вкладка Формат (или Format Comment).
  4. Перейдите в раздел Фигура (Shape Styles) и выберите одну из предварительно заданных форм: прямоугольник, скруглённый прямоугольник, овалы, стрелки или выноски.

Обратите внимание: в некоторых версиях Excel (например, Excel 2016) список доступных фигур может быть ограничен. Если вам нужны более сложные контуры (например, пятиконечная звезда или молния), придётся использовать обходной путь — см. раздел про пользовательские фигуры.

Щёлкните по ячейке с примечанием — оно должно быть видно на экране|Убедитесь, что примечание не заблокировано (нет значка замка в строке состояния)|Проверьте, что у вас есть права на редактирование файла (не режим "только чтение")|Сохраните резервную копию файла, если работаете с важными данными-->

После выбора формы вы можете дополнительно настроить:

  • 🎨 Цвет заливки — через вкладку Заливка фигуры (Shape Fill). Поддерживаются сплошные цвета, градиенты и даже текстурные заливки (например, "бумага" или "мрамор").
  • 🖋️ Цвет и толщину границы — в разделе Контур фигуры (Shape Outline). Здесь можно сделать рамку пунктирной или вовсе убрать её.
  • 📐 Размер и пропорции — потянув за угловые маркеры рамки. Удерживайте Shift, чтобы сохранить соотношение сторон.
⚠️ Внимание: Если после изменения формы примечание стало плохо читаемым (например, тёмный текст на тёмном фоне), Excel автоматически инвертирует цвет шрифта. Однако в ручном режиме это не всегда срабатывает — проверяйте контрастность вручную!

Способ 2: Использование вкладки «Формат фигуры» для точной настройки

Для пользователей, которым нужны продвинутые настройки (например, полупрозрачность, тени или 3D-эффекты), стандартного контекстного меню будет недостаточно. В этом случае поможет панель Формат фигуры (Format Shape), которая открывается:

  • Двойным кликом по рамке примечания.
  • Через контекстное меню: правый клик → Формат фигуры.
  • Горячими клавишами: выделите примечание и нажмите Ctrl+1.

Панель разделена на три ключевых раздела:

Раздел Возможности Пример использования
Заливка и линии Сплошной цвет, градиент, узор, прозрачность, тип и толщина линии Создание "невидимых" примечаний с прозрачной заливкой и серой рамкой для минималистичных отчётов
Эффекты Тень, подсветка, сглаживание, 3D-формат, поворот объёмной фигуры Добавление объёмных стрелок для указания на конкретные ячейки в диаграммах
Размер и свойства Точные координаты, привязка к ячейке, защита от изменений Фиксация положения примечания при изменении размера ячеек

Один из самых полезных, но малоизвестных приёмов — привязка примечания к ячейке. По умолчанию комментарий "плавает" рядом с ячейкой, но его можно зафиксировать, убрав галочку Перемещать и изменять размер вместе с ячейками в разделе Свойства. Это актуально для таблиц, где часто добавляются/удаляются строки или столбцы.

Способ 3: Создание пользовательских фигур для примечаний

Возможности стандартных фигур в Excel ограничены, но есть способ обойти это ограничение: превратить любое примечание в произвольную фигуру с помощью инструмента Вставка → Фигуры. Вот как это работает:

  1. Создайте новое примечание или отредактируйте существующее (правый клик → Изменить примечание).
  2. Удалите весь текст из примечания (он нам больше не понадобится).
  3. Перейдите на вкладку ВставкаФигуры и выберите нужный контур (например, пятиконечная звезда или молния).
  4. Нарисуйте фигуру поверх пустого примечания, затем щёлкните по ней правой кнопкой и выберите Добавить текст.
  5. Введите текст комментария и отформатируйте его. Теперь удалите исходное примечание — на листе останется только ваша кастомная фигура.

Преимущества этого метода:

  • 🌟 Доступно более 150 различных фигур, включая блок-схемы, выноски с надписями и даже символы химических элементов.
  • 🔗 Фигуру можно привязать к ячейке через Формат фигуры → Свойства → Прикрепить к ячейке.
  • 🎭 Поддерживаются анимации (в Excel 365) — например, можно сделать так, чтобы примечание появлялось при наведении на ячейку.
⚠️ Внимание: При таком подходе теряется функциональность стандартных примечаний — например, нельзя будет использовать горячие клавиши Shift+F2 для редактирования. Также эти фигуры не отобразятся в режиме Просмотр → Примечания.
Как вернуть стандартное примечание после замены на фигуру?

Если вы заменили примечание фигурой, но хотите вернуть исходный комментарий, откройте историю изменений файла (Файл → Сведения → История версий) и восстановите предыдущую версию. Или создайте новое примечание вручную, скопировав текст из фигуры.

Способ 4: Изменение формы всех примечаний одновременно

Если в вашей таблице десятки или сотни примечаний, редактировать каждое вручную — нерационально. К счастью, в Excel есть инструмент для пакетного форматирования. Вот как им пользоваться:

  1. Нажмите Ctrl+G, введите в поле Ссылка диапазон ячеек с примечаниями (например, A1:Z100) и нажмите ОК.
  2. Перейдите на вкладку РецензированиеПоказать все примечания (Show All Comments).
  3. Удерживая Ctrl, выделите рамки всех видимых примечаний (они подсветятся маркерами).
  4. Щёлкните правой кнопкой по любой из выделенных рамок и выберите Формат фигуры.

Теперь все изменения (цвет, форма, шрифт) будут применены ко всем выбранным примечаниям одновременно. Этот метод работает и в обратную сторону: если вам нужно вернуть стандартный вид для группы комментариев, выделите их и нажмите Сброс формата в контекстном меню.

Для автоматизации процесса можно использовать макрос VBA:

Sub FormatAllComments()

Dim cmnt As Comment

For Each cmnt In ActiveSheet.Comments

With cmnt.Shape

.Fill.ForeColor.RGB = RGB(255, 255, 200) ' Светло-жёлтый фон

.Line.ForeColor.RGB = RGB(100, 100, 100) ' Тёмно-серая рамка

' Дополнительные настройки здесь

End With

Next cmnt

End Sub

Чтобы запустить этот код, нажмите Alt+F11, вставьте его в модуль и выполните через F5. Подробнее о настройке макросов читайте в разделе про VBA.

Каждый день|Несколько раз в неделю|Редко, только для важных пометок|Никогда не пользовался-->

Способ 5: Использование VBA для динамического изменения форм

Для пользователей, работающих с Excel VBA, открываются почти безграничные возможности кастомизации. Например, можно написать скрипт, который будет автоматически менять форму примечания в зависимости от значения в ячейке:

  • 📛 Красный ромб — если значение меньше 0.
  • 🟢 Зелёное облако — если значение больше 100.
  • ⚠️ Жёлтый треугольник — для предупреждений.

Пример кода для такого динамического форматирования:

Sub AutoFormatCommentsBasedOnValue()

Dim cell As Range

Dim cmnt As Comment

For Each cell In ActiveSheet.UsedRange

If Not cell.Comment Is Nothing Then

Set cmnt = cell.Comment

Select Case cell.Value

Case Is < 0

cmnt.Shape.AutoShapeType = msoShapeDiamond ' Ромб

cmnt.Shape.Fill.ForeColor.RGB = RGB(255, 100, 100) ' Красный

Case Is > 100

cmnt.Shape.AutoShapeType = msoShapeCloud ' Облако

cmnt.Shape.Fill.ForeColor.RGB = RGB(100, 255, 100) ' Зелёный

Case Else

cmnt.Shape.AutoShapeType = msoShapeRectangle ' Прямоугольник

cmnt.Shape.Fill.ForeColor.RGB = RGB(255, 255, 200) ' Жёлтый

End Select

End If

Next cell

End Sub

Чтобы этот код работал автоматически при изменении данных, добавьте его в событие Worksheet_Change:

Private Sub Worksheet_Change(ByVal Target As Range)

Call AutoFormatCommentsBasedOnValue

End Sub

Распространённые ошибки и как их избежать

При работе с формами примечаний пользователи часто сталкиваются с типичными проблемами. Вот самые частые из них и способы их решения:

Проблема Причина Решение
Примечание не меняет форму Файл открыт в режиме совместимости с Excel 97–2003 Сохраните файл в формате .xlsx или .xlsm
Текст в примечании обрезается Слишком маленький размер фигуры или неверный перенос слов Увеличьте рамку или включите Переносить текст по словам в настройках фигуры
Изменения формы не сохраняются Примечание привязано к защищённой ячейке Снимите защиту с листа (Рецензирование → Снять защиту листа)
Фигура примечания становится чёрной при печати Настройки принтера игнорируют цвета заливки В настройках печати выберите Качество: Высокое и Печатать цвета и изображения фона

Ещё одна распространённая ошибка — потеря примечаний при копировании данных. Если вы копируете ячейку с комментарием в другую книгу, форма примечания может сброситься до стандартной. Чтобы этого избежать, используйте Специальную вставкуПримечания.

⚠️ Внимание: В Excel Online возможности кастомизации примечаний сильно урезаны. Вы сможете изменить только текст и цвет рамки, но не форму. Для полноценной работы используйте десктопную версию.

Дополнительные советы по работе с примечаниями

Помимо изменения формы, есть ещё несколько приёмов, которые помогут сделать работу с примечаниями эффективнее:

  • 🔍 Быстрый поиск примечаний: нажмите Ctrl+F, в поле поиска введите ?, затем нажмите Параметры → Формат → Примечание.
  • 📌 Закрепление важных комментариев: добавьте в текст примечания символ ! в начале — так его будет легче найти через поиск.
  • 🖼️ Вставка изображений в примечания: скопируйте картинку, отредактируйте примечание и вставьте (Ctrl+V). Работает в Excel 2013 и новее.
  • 🔄 Экспорт примечаний в Word: используйте макрос для преобразования всех комментариев в документированный отчёт.

Если вы часто работаете с большими таблицами, полезно настроить условное форматирование для ячеек с примечаниями. Например, можно сделать так, чтобы все ячейки с комментариями подсвечивались светло-голубым цветом. Для этого:

  1. Выделите диапазон ячеек.
  2. Перейдите в Главная → Условное форматирование → Создать правило.
  3. Выберите Использовать формулу... и введите =NOT(ISBLANK(CELL("contents", A1))).
  4. Задайте нужный формат (например, светло-голубой фон).

FAQ: Частые вопросы о настройке примечаний в Excel

Можно ли изменить форму примечания в Excel для Mac?

Да, но функционал ограничен по сравнению с Windows-версией. В Excel для Mac доступны только базовые фигуры (прямоугольник, овалы, стрелки), а некоторые эффекты (например, 3D) могут не отображаться корректно. Для полноценной работы рекомендуем использовать Excel 365 через браузер или Parallels Desktop.

Как сделать так, чтобы примечания автоматически изменяли цвет в зависимости от данных?

Это можно реализовать только через VBA. Создайте макрос, который будет проверять значение ячейки и менять цвет примечания. Пример кода:

Sub ColorCommentsByValue()

Dim cell As Range

For Each cell In Selection

If Not cell.Comment Is Nothing Then

If cell.Value < 0 Then

cell.Comment.Shape.Fill.ForeColor.RGB = RGB(255, 100, 100) ' Красный

ElseIf cell.Value > 100 Then

cell.Comment.Shape.Fill.ForeColor.RGB = RGB(100, 255, 100) ' Зелёный

End If

End If

Next cell

End Sub

Чтобы запускать его автоматически, добавьте в событие Worksheet_Change.

Почему после изменения формы примечание стало невидимым при печати?

Это типичная проблема, связанная с настройками принтера. Чтобы исправить:

  1. Перейдите в Файл → Печать.
  2. Нажмите Параметры страницы (шестерёнка в правом углу).
  3. Вкладка Лист → поставьте галочку Печатать примечания и выберите Как на листе.
  4. Убедитесь, что в настройках принтера включён режим Цветная печать (даже если у вас чёрно-белый принтер).

Если проблема осталась, попробуйте экспортировать лист в PDF (Файл → Экспорт → PDF) — в этом формате примечания отображаются корректнее.

Можно ли добавить в примечание гиперссылку?

Прямо в текст примечания — нет, но есть обходной путь:

  1. Создайте примечание и введите текст (например, "Подробнее здесь").
  2. Скопируйте ячейку с гиперссылкой (или создайте её через Вставка → Гиперссылка).
  3. Откройте примечание для редактирования и вставьте скопированную ячейку (Ctrl+V).

Теперь при клике на текст в примечании будет открываться ссылка. Работает в Excel 2016 и новее.

Как вернуть стандартный вид всем примечаниям на листе?

Есть два способа:

  1. Ручной сброс:
    1. Выделите все ячейки с примечаниями (Ctrl+GВыделить → Примечания).
    2. Нажмите Ctrl+1, перейдите в раздел Формат фигуры и нажмите Сброс.
  2. Через VBA:
    Sub ResetAllComments()
    

    Dim cmnt As Comment

    For Each cmnt In ActiveSheet.Comments

    cmnt.Shape.Fill.ForeColor.RGB = RGB(255, 255, 204) ' Стандартный жёлтый

    cmnt.Shape.Line.ForeColor.RGB = RGB(192, 192, 192) ' Стандартная серая рамка

    cmnt.Shape.AutoShapeType = msoShapeRectangle ' Стандартный прямоугольник

    Next cmnt

    End Sub